I had a hard time with the Protein Shakes as well, it's like you just can not do it after a point. I would suggest focus on fluids first. Try other sources of Protein. One day I took a 1/4 cup of vanilla Greek yogurt and mixed in one scoop of strawberry whey protein with 25 gm protein per scoop. It didn't taste the greatest but was a small amount to get down and a significant amount of protein and not a shake. Or sometimes just changing flavors helps. Try not to over do it for pain. Take it easy. Walk around the house and just give yourself a chance to heal. I spent the first 2 weeks with a pillow on the couch watching tv and just walking, nothing more strenuous. I know as mom's you always feel like there's something to do, but try to let it go for a bit and rest. I hope you feel better.
